1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a verbal phrase?

Back

A verbal phrase is a group of words that includes a verb form and functions as a noun, adjective, or adverb in a sentence.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is an infinitive?

Back

An infinitive is the base form of a verb, usually preceded by 'to', that can function as a noun, adjective, or adverb. Example: 'to run'.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a gerund?

Back

A gerund is a verb form ending in -ing that functions as a noun. Example: 'Running is fun.'

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a participle?

Back

A participle is a verb form that can function as an adjective. There are present participles (ending in -ing) and past participles (usually ending in -ed or -en). Example: 'The running water.'

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the difference between a gerund and a present participle?

Back

A gerund functions as a noun, while a present participle functions as an adjective or part of a verb tense.
